    You may be interested in a session being held on Saturday:

    Essential Skills for Secondary Education Instructors

    This workshop is aimed at secondary educators who currently, or will soon teach technical theatre coursework at their home schools and wish to expand their competencies in a variety of areas. Special attention will be paid to effective teaching strategies, both in the classroom and the shop focusing on lighting, scenery, costuming, and stage management best practices. Participants will work with industry experts and professional grade lighting equipment to develop core competencies in a variety of areas. Additional focus will be on the implementation of newer, energy saving technologies in high school theatres and preparing students and faculty/staff to to build eSET certification into their curriculum along with other recognized educational resources.

    The class is still fleshing out so the topics will vary a bit but will be a good opportunity for exploring teaching technical theatre.

    Welcome to USITT Josh!  You'll have a great time there.  If you have not done so, I highly recommend that you sign-up for a full access pass that will allow you to attend the workshop sessions of your choice.  The workshop sessions are a great way to connect to like-minded people.  It's always a challenge to try to pick sessions that don't overlap so you don't miss-out.  Also, definitely plan on attending the New Product Introduction and Charity Auction.  It's a wild night of chaos that brings us all together.  (Be sure to pack a bundle of 5's, 10's, and 20's so you can participate and get some of the most insane deals you'll ever see on gear and travel).  Visit the Expo floor and talk to the vendors. They are a wealth of information - just ask questions and they will overload you with answers.  Take pictures and post them to your social accounts so your friends will know what they missed by not coming.
